Note that a full listing of the command line options for slic can be printed out with the following command:
Wiki Markupnoformat |
---|
> slic -h Wed Oct 16 11:53:20 2019 :: OKAY :: SlicApplication :: SLIC is starting. SLIC ************** * SLIC Usage * ************** Command line usage: slic [single_macro_path] slic [options] Interactive usage: slic -n ************************ * Command Line Options * ************************ Option Full Name Macro Command Description ------------------------------------------------------------ -h --help /slic/usage Print SLIC usage. -? --help /slic/usage Print SLIC usage. -n --interactive /control/interactive Start a Geant4 interactive session. -v --version /slic/version Print SLIC version. -m --macro /control/execute Execute Geant4 commands from a file. -g --lcdd-url /lcdd/url Set LCDD geometry file URL. -i --event-file /generator/filename Set event input file full path. -o --lcio-file /lcio/filename Set name of LCIO output file. -p --lcio-path /lcio/path Set directory for LCIO output. -O --autoname /lcio/autoname Automatically name the LCIO output file. -x --lcio-delete /lcio/fileExists delete Delete an existing LCIO file. -r --run-events /run/beamOn Run # of events. -s --skip-events /generator/skipEvents Set number of events to skip. -l --physics-list /physics/select Set Geant4 physics list. -L --log-file /log/filename Set logfile name. -d --seed /random/seed Set the random seed. (No argument seeds with time.) -G --dump-gdml /lcdd/dumpGDML Dump geometry to GDML file. -c --optical /physics/enableOptical Enable optical physics processes. -P --pdg-file /physics/setPDGFile Set location of particle.tbl file. -V --lcdd-version /lcdd/version Set the version of the GDML setup tag. -S --lcdd-setup /lcdd/setupName Set the name of the GDML setup tag. |

One can also generate events internally using the GEANT4 General Particle Source. One can either issue commands on the interactive command line, or invoke them via a Geant4 macro.
Wiki Markupnoformat |
---|
slic -g detector.lcdd -m G4commands.mac -O |

Here is a simple example to generate 100k single 4.56 GeV electrons isotropically over a fixed range in theta and uniformly in phi:
Wiki Markupnoformat |
---|
/generator/select gps /gps/particle e- /gps/position 0 0 0 cm /gps/energy 1 GeV /gps/ang/type iso /gps/ang/mintheta 170 deg /gps/ang/maxtheta 180 deg /gps/ang/minphi 0 deg /gps/ang/maxphi 360 deg /run/beamOn 100000 |
